Iyzico
Adapter Iyzico
The Iyzico adapter is integrated, but has not been actively used for an extended period, or could not undergo thorough testing. Since using some capabilities might require further development, we encourage you to reach out directly to your Customer Success Manager or contact our Support Team in the IXOPAY Customer Experience Portal.
Iyzico Provider Settlement
Configure the following Parameters for the Settlements Provider Data Fetcher to fetch Settlement (csv format) via an API (see Edit Provider Settlement Data Fetcher Provider Level):
- Fill in the expected Interval in which the Provider Settlement File should be fetched - days, hours
- Select the Adapter Izyco
- Enable Testmode to test fetching of Provider Settlements from Izyco
- Fill in the mandatory Extra Data: sftpUsername - the usernameIXOPAY platform's system can use to access the csv files on the sftp server
- Fill in the mandatory Extra Data: sftpPassword - the passwordIXOPAY platform’s system can use to access the csv files on the sftp server
- Fill in the mandatory Extra Data: sftpHostname - the name of the sftp host where the settlement csv files reside
- Fill in the mandatory Extra Data: port - the port used on the sftp host (usually 22)
- Fill in the mandatory Extra Data: rootDir - the path in which the folder of csv files (named "Izyco") is located

| Iyzico | IXOPAY platform | Default (if not set by Iyzico) |
|---|---|---|
| settlementResolvedDate | Transaction settlement date | None - required |
| paidPrice | Transaction settlement amount | None - required |
| settlementCurrency | Transaction settlement currency | None - required |
| transactionType | Transaction type | None - required |
| basketId | Transaction id | None - required |
| conversationId | Transaction settlement reference id | None - required |
| iyziCommissionFee | Transaction fee amount of type "commission" (with currency defined in Izyco field settlementCurrency) | None - required |
| iyziCommissionRateAmount | Transaction fee amount of type "markup" (with currency defined in Izyco field settlementCurrency) | None - required |
| netAmount | Line item of type actual-settlement-amount | None - required |
| settlementCurrency | Settlement currency used for populating line items | None - required |
| totalMerchantPayoutAmount | Line item of type actual-net-settlement-amount | None - required |
| totalPaymentAmount | Extra line item of type "unknown" saved for reference with title totalPaymentAmount | None - required |
| totalRefundAmount | Extra line item of type "unknown" saved for reference with title totalRefundAmount | None - required |
| bankReferenceCode | Mapped to paymentReference field of every settled transaction | None - required |